Overview
- The Commercial Platforms are a key differentiator to win and grow Commercial business.
- The Smart Data platform is central to our commercial strategy and success.
- Smart Data Real Account Management (SDRAM) offers Issuers and their Corporates account management services within Smart Data.
- This Product Manager role will support the Director of Product Management for SDRAM in delivering differentiating product features and functionality.
- The Product Manager will actively contribute to the agile development process testing and release support.
- This role will collaborate closely with Engineering User experience design and other stakeholders to ensure the end-to-end quality of Smart Data features and enhancements.
- This role reports to the Director of Product Management Smart Data Real Account Management.
